Freedom OSS, a leader in Integrated Cloud Service Management (ICSM) focusing on large enterprise environments, claimed that it has an agreement with the leading next-generation, studio Lionsgate Entertainment, to move its SAP (News - Alert) system into a cloud computing environment hosted by Amazon Web Services (AWS). With this move, IT cost will be reduced, efficiency will be improved and IT infrastructure consumption will be minimized by varying the amount of energy and computing power to fit specific project needs.

Industry leading cloud solution, “vNOC,” has been implemented during Lionsgate’s ERP migration process to operate and manage SAP.
Joel Davne, CEO of Freedom OSS, said in a statement, “The migration of a production SAP solution onto the AWS platform is a clear signal that cloud computing is being adopted by large enterprises. ERP represents one of the few remaining barriers that most industry observers felt would take longer to achieve.”
After receiving cost estimates for a data center in Santa Monica, Calif., Lionsgate realized the value of cloud computing. Leo Collins, executive vice president and chief information officer at Lionsgate, mentioned, “The computer room in Santa Monica was very expensive and moving it to less expensive space still was not cost-effective and the difficulties of managing two physical facilities, with many network and server devices recede into the background when you embrace cloud computing services.”
Lionsgate is currently moving its SAP production environment into the cloud that includes core ERP system, AP, AR, general ledgers and business intelligence applications as well as the entertainment focused, meta data and rights management systems. By moving these application into cloud, Lionsgate can save money and effort on storage management and can have more efficient data backup and disaster recovery, Environmental demands in expensive office space is reduced and it has to pay only for computing services used at any given time.
"I'm in the cloud, my SAP production and testing is literally anywhere now. I can instantly bring up 500 people on email without buying a single server. The cloud is just a more flexible, reliable IT environment that will grow with us and save money," concluded Collins.
